Tom Holland’s Spider-Man: Brand New Day has rewritten box office history by delivering the biggest opening day ever in North America. The Marvel-Sony blockbuster earned a staggering $168 million on its first day, overtaking Avengers: Endgame and setting the stage for a record-breaking opening weekend.Marvel Studios and Sony Pictures have another blockbuster on their hands as Spider-Man: Brand New Day continues its dream run at the global box office. The fourth standalone Spider-Man film starring Tom Holland has officially set a new North American opening-day record, surpassing the long-standing benchmark established by Avengers: Endgame.The superhero film collected $72 million from paid previews and advance screenings, breaking Avengers: Endgame’s previous preview record of $60 million. It then added more than $95 million on its first official day, taking its total opening-day earnings to an impressive $168 million. The figure was confirmed by Sony, making it the highest opening-day collection ever recorded in North America.Brand New Day Eyes Biggest Opening Weekend in HistoryInitial industry projections estimated the film would earn between $180 million and $190 million during its opening weekend. Strong advance bookings later pushed those estimates to $250 million, and following its massive opening day, Sony has now raised expectations to around $300 million.Trade analysts, however, believe the film could perform even better. If Brand New Day maintains its momentum over the weekend, it has a realistic chance of surpassing Avengers: Endgame’s all-time North American opening weekend record of $357 million.Spider-Man Dominates the Indian Box Office.The film has also enjoyed a phenomenal start in India. Released a day earlier than in the United States, Spider-Man: Brand New Day has earned approximately ₹176 crore net (around ₹211 crore gross) within its first three days.Its performance has already outpaced the opening collections of several major Hindi blockbusters, including Pathaan, Tiger 3, Dhurandhar, and Dangal, highlighting the enduring popularity of the Spider-Man franchise among Indian audiences.Star Cast and Story.Directed by Destin Daniel Cretton, Spider-Man: Brand New Day sees Tom Holland return as Peter Parker. The film also features Zendaya as MJ, Jacob Batalon as Ned, Sadie Sink, Mark Ruffalo, and Jon Bernthal in pivotal roles.The story follows Peter Parker as he begins a new chapter in a world that no longer remembers his identity, forcing him to rebuild his life while embracing the responsibilities of Spider-Man once again.
